First edition of NExT exam to be held in February 2028 for MBBS 2024 batch: NMC
The first edition of National Exit Test (NExT) will be conducted in the year 2028. The MBBS batch of 2024 will be the first batch to take the NExT.

The decision has been published in the academic calendar published by the National Medical Commission (NMC). The Competency-Based Medical Education (CBME) regulations 2023 uploaded on the NMC website states that NExT step 1 will be conducted in February 2028 and NExT step 2 will be held in February 2029.
Earlier, union health minister Mansukh Mandaviya had said that the first batch of MBBS students who will have to appear for the National Exit Test (NExT) will be the MBBS 2020 batch. The 2019 MBBS batch will not have to take the NExT. AIIMS Delhi was scheduled to conduct NExT mock test on July 28.However, NMC in its notice dated July 13 postponed the exam till further notice.
MBBS students all over the country were protesting against the NExT stating that they have not got enough time to prepare for the exam and it will increase their academic burden.
What is NExT exam?
National Medical Council (NMC) in its official notification stated that NExT will be conducted for MBBS students who want to practice in India. National Exit Test (NExT) shall form the basis of certifying the eligibility of the medical graduate to register to practice the modern system of medicine in India and therefore serve as a Licentiate Examination and determining the eligibility and ranking for the purpose of admission of those desirous of pursuing further Postgraduate Medical Education in the country in broad medical specialities and therefore serve as an entrance Examination for admission to courses of Postgraduate Medical Education. NExT, therefore, will replace NEET PG and FMGE (Foreign Medical Graduates Exam).
